Someone on NC.com (can’t remember who gulp ) mentioned a british website with organic products for curls - ironsunorganics.co.uk. I checked it out and they have a good range but I couldn’t pull up any ingredients to look for protein. Anyway, I contacted them with my dilemma and the lovely lady, Olayinka, emailed me back. She has now organised the products with low or no protein in a separate category with the full list of ingredients! What a lovely lady she is! Will definitely try something from this website - everything looks very good.  grin
